Kbin feature requests may be better housed in the project's issue tracker

There have been a lot of threads these last few days discussing the current feature-set of /kbin. While it's good to go out there and get a sense of what's the prevailing opinions are, it's probably actually better for the project as a whole that actual feature requests be lodged at the issue tracker.

https://codeberg.org/Kbin/kbin-core/issues

Open source projects, and their code repositories, are often treated as the exclusive domain of coders, but the rest of us can actually help guide project engineers by contributing ideas. And like all contributions, they really belong in the project's repository, where they can be viewed in a single location not only by the project's maintainer, but by other code contributors who may see ideas listed and want to take on the task of implementing them.

So, rather than having the same feature down in the 87th comment of a dozen different threads, where code contributors are not likely to see them, let's get them up there front and centre!
